python——基于Pandas读取asc文件并保存为csv格式
文章目录
- 读取ASC文件
- 保存为CSV文件
- 完整转换代码
读取ASC文件
利用pandas的read_csv
即可读取asc
格式的文件:
framefile = pd.read_csv(filepath,skiprows=4,encoding="gbk",engine='python',sep=' ',delimiter=None, index_col=False,header=None,skipinitialspace=True)
保存为CSV文件
framefile.to_csv("filename.csv",index=False,sep=',')
完整转换代码
import pandas as pdif __name__ == '__main__':filepath = "./2021MCM/rastert_feature1.asc"ASCfile = pd.read_csv(filepath,skiprows=4,encoding="gbk",engine='python',sep=' ',delimiter=None, index_col=False,header=None,skipinitialspace=True)# print(ASCfile.columns)# print(ASCfile.iloc[0:,0:1]) # 行,列 = [:, :]# print(ASCfile)ASCfile.to_csv("rastert_feature1.csv",index=False,sep=',')
读取后的asc文件:
参考文章:
- 读取asc文件
- python写入csv文件的几种方法总结
python——基于Pandas读取asc文件并保存为csv格式相关推荐
- python读取mat文件格式_Python读取mat文件,并保存为pickle格式的方法
这两天在搞Theano,要把mat文件转成pickle格式载入Python. Matlab是把一维数组当做n*1的矩阵的,但Numpy里还是有vector和matrix的区别,Theano也是对二者做 ...
- 将文件夹内多个子文件里的Excel数据合并到一个文件,保存为CSV格式
将文件夹内多个子文件里的Excel数据合并到一个文件,保存为CSV格式 使用条件: Excel文件必须是xlsx格式,且数据结构一致,方可用以下代码. # 第一步 导入模块 import pandas ...
- Python使用pandas读取Excel文件数据和预处理小案例
假设有Excel文件data.xlsx,其中内容为 现在需要将这个Excel文件中的数据读入pandas,并且在后续的处理中不关心ID列,还需要把sex列的female替换为1,把sex列的male替 ...
- 【Python】Pandas读取tsv文件
TSV文件和CSV的文件的区别是:前者使用\t作为分隔符,后者使用,作为分隔符. 使用pandas读取tsv文件的代码如下: train=pd.read_csv('test.tsv', sep='\t ...
- Python使用pandas读取Excel文件多个WorkSheet的数据并绘制柱状图和热力图
问题描述:在当前文件夹中有一个存放同一门课程两个班级同学成绩的Excel文件"学生成绩.xlsx",每个工作表中存放一个班级的成绩.编写程序,使用pandas读取其中的数据,然后绘 ...
- 学python看什么书好1002无标题-如何使用pandas读取txt文件中指定的列(有无标题)
最近在倒腾一个txt文件,因为文件太大,所以给切割成了好几个小的文件,只有第一个文件有标题,从第二个开始就没有标题了. 我的需求是取出指定的列的数据,踩了些坑给研究出来了. import pandas ...
- python按列读取txt文件_如何使用pandas读取txt文件中指定的列(有无标题)
最近在倒腾一个txt文件,因为文件太大,所以给切割成了好几个小的文件,只有第一个文件有标题,从第二个开始就没有标题了. 我的需求是取出指定的列的数据,踩了些坑给研究出来了. import pandas ...
- python读取指定路径txt文件-如何使用pandas读取txt文件中指定的列(有无标题)
最近在倒腾一个txt文件,因为文件太大,所以给切割成了好几个小的文件,只有第一个文件有标题,从第二个开始就没有标题了. 我的需求是取出指定的列的数据,踩了些坑给研究出来了. import pandas ...
- 几行Python代码生成饭店营业额模拟数据并保存为CSV文件
CSV文件是一种通用的.简单的文件格式,以纯文本形式存储表格数据(数字和文本),在多个领域都有广泛应用,经常用来在不同程序之间交换数据. 下面的代码使用Python标准库datetime和random ...
- python 保存pdf文件_PyPDF2读取PDF文件内容保存到本地TXT实例
我就废话不多说了,大家还是直接看代码吧! from PyPDF2.pdf import PdfFileReader import pandas as pd def Pdf_to_txt(pdf): f ...
最新文章
- 总结一下各种IO方式
- java sftp nologin_SFTP连接通过Java询问奇怪的身份验证
- 一文读懂P Quant与 Q Quant ,量化交易与金融工程
- linux如何添加默认路由表_linux 添加静态路由
- asp.net添加自定义用户控件并传值
- matlab仿真限幅发散,GSM通信系统性能分析与MATLAB仿真.doc
- python执行速度太慢为什么还_为什么你写的Python运行的那么慢呢?
- 自行编译cups绕过错误:file /etc/rc.d/rc.local from install of systemd conflicts with file from
- win10计算机管理字体糊,完美解决:Win10系统字体模糊解决教程
- 使用阿里云加速器 配置 Docker 镜像加速器
- matlab 字符查找函数,matlab字符函数
- android加速传感器应用,如何在android智能手机中使用加速计传感器查找位移距离?...
- 计算机专业就业崩溃,计算机专业就业“遇冷说”引发争议
- 服务器终端性能测试之MBW内存测试
- 什么叫死区时间_死区时间
- ArcEngine代码 数据导入
- 求一元多项式pn(x)=a(i)x^i(i~n的和)的值pn(x0),并确定算法中每一语句的执行次数和整个算法的时间复杂度。注意选择你认为较好的输入和输出方法。本题的输入为a(i)(i=0,1,.
- 54. 流编辑器sed技术概览
- 实现跨越多个云的无缝云数据管理
- 2023年上半年系统集成项目管理工程师什么时候报名?(附报考流程)